EXPO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2024 in Review

329 of the 6,942 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Exponent (EXPO) for Q1 2024, worth a combined $3.88B — down 7% from $4.17B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 57 funds closed out of EXPO and 34 opened new positions — a net loss of 23 holders — while 145 trimmed existing stakes and 105 added.

The largest buyer was Invesco, adding an estimated $35.6M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$76.6M.
